East West Gas Pipeline

Highlights

Longest 1375 km length, natural gas cross country

pipeline traversing through 630+ Villages in Four

States

Largest Diameter, 48 inch, Pipeline

Highest Capacity, 80 MMSCMD,

Highest Operating Pressure, 98 bar g,

Total 27 Aero Derivative & 5 Industrial Machines with Total 900+ MW.

100% Remote Operation from Mumbai Pipeline Operation Centre (POC) with Standby POC at Gadimoga in AP

Unique Emergency Response Support System

EWPL Facilities Design & Construction Main Line Valves (MLV)

– MLV are provided at every 35-40 km for isolation of pipeline during emergency & repairs.

– These are locally as well as remotely operated type

Compressor Stations– Compressor Stations (CS) placed at 130-160 km

intervals to maintain desired pressure in pipeline.

– Aero derivative machines with 93+ MW capacity at

each CS SCADA System

– Provided for monitoring and control of pipeline operations.

Leak Detection System– It extends the functionality to perform leak detection,

leak location, pig tracking, predictive modeling, look ahead modeling and operator Training
